                     /isolation_source="Mycobacterium bovis subsp. bovis strain
                     AF2122/97. This strain is a fully virulent strain that was
                     isolated in 1997 in the UK from a cow suffering necrotic
                     lesions in lung and bronchomediastinal lymph nodes. The
                     strain was also reported to infect and persist in badgers
                     that are considered to be a significant source of bovine
                     infection."

                     comp signature. REMARK-M.bovis-M.tuberculosis: In
                     Mycobacterium tuberculosis strain H37Rv, ugpA exists as a
                     single gene. In Mycobacterium bovis, a frameshift due to a
                     single base deletion (t-*) splits ugpA into 2 parts, ugpAa
                     and ugpAb. Mb2860c found to be expressed during
                     exponential growth in Sauton's minimal media by
                     RNA-sequencing."
